I have not asked this previously, but I wonder whether the varying results might be influenced by how hard a player plucks their strings ?

The character of sound produced by looser [lighter gauge] strings ought to be more sensitive to variances in plucking than heavier gauge strings, but short scale basses may just make that factor more obvious.

On my Hofner Ignition Club bass, I put short scale LaBella Low Tension Flats [yes, those do fit, at 32.25" of wrap], and I have not noticed tuning nor intonation problems, though I understand the theory about why some folks might be having such problems, and originally steered away from the lightest available sets beforehand, even in LaBella.

Those strings are fairly light [42-56-75-100, IIRC], but not as light as some of the other examples being discussed, so yes, my own results are inconclusive.

On my 2010 USA Gibson SG bass, I put short scale GHS Brite Flats, which I already liked in long scale light gauge on my Ric, and which just happen to be only available in the heavier gauge in shorts, and they seem fine too, but as I said are a good deal heavier [49-62-84-109, IIRC].

That is my experience as well. It also gets down to gauge. There are strings out there that will tolerate a cut of 90 or 95, but the same design in 105+ will not tolerate the cut.
 
Cutting strings is not a good solution. Strings are pulled to playing tension when wound. If you just cut a string designed for a longer scale, it is never pulled to its intended tension. This will affect the sound, usually to the muddy end.

This is likely how short scales got a bad rap over the years - player cutting long scale strings down to use and giving really muddy sound.
There is no such thing as strings designed for a longer scale: most manufacturers make short, medium and long-scale strings that are identically made across sets save for winding length. Using a long-scale string on a short-scale, unless damage occurs at the tuning post, is no more improper, tone-wise, than using it on the "intended" scale but tuning down a step.
Many people believe that, but my experience is the opposite: fatties for full scale, lights for short. 90s and 95s feel / play / sound better than 105s and 110s on my short scales. And vice versa.
I think it is a complex function, with diminishing returns: if you brought this reasoning to the extreme consequences, you could still succeed in tuning your (22" scale?) mini-VI project to your originally intended pitch (E1-E3) by choosing even *lighter* strings than those in the Bass VI set (024-084) you've tried on it. However...good luck playing that!

What I think is that there is a "sour spot" for specific gauges and pitches for specific scales, and in order to de-mud the tone (mud being in the ear of the be-player, of course), you need to either go heavier (with increased inharmonicity up the neck) or lighter (with possible playability issues, depending on touch and style): both can result in a tighter tone (with peaks in different spots of the spectrum).

Yes and no.

Not all string makers publish detailed info on this, but of those which I have found who do, there is a term called 'unit weight', which may shed some light on this.

D'Addario for example seems to say what you just said about theirs, as all scale lengths of a certain gauge of individual bass string have the identical unit weight.

However, GHS states that their short and medium scale versions of bass strings of many types DO have a different unit weight than their long scale strings of identical gauges, which means that something is different among them, either in the materials and/or in how they are put together, and their rep Jon did recently admit this in another thread here, but when asked to elaborate, he chose not to go into details as to exactly what they are doing differently [trade secrets, I guess].

In construction, it could be core size vs wrap thickness, and/or how many wraps it takes to reach the final outside diameter of a string, especially on the thicker gauge strings in a set.

That [construction] would also go a long way towards explaining why some strings of the same gauge 'feel' stiffer than others, when installed onto the same bass.

I'm well aware of what you mention, and concede that there are exceptions: I often quote the old D'Addario EPS170S (short-scale XL nickel-plated steel 50-105 set), whose strings were shown to have higher unit weights than the corresponding long-scale strings of same gauges in the old D'Addario string tension chart .pdf (they don't bother making them that way anymore), and the super-long scale Thomastik-Infeld Jazz Flats (JF364), having 3 out of 4 strings whose unit lengths calculate very close to the corresponding long- and short-scale versions, with slightly larger gauges, which I tentatively attributed to them having a larger silk inlay but otherwise identical metal components, in order to bring down the twang of the treble strings on a super-long scale instrument.
The differences in linear mass between two GHS strings (from the same product line) of same diameter but different winding lengths may be due to specific tonal and/or tension goals for the "intended" scale: what I meant is that using either on the other scale (one such experiment being of course harder to set up, unless one can magically lengthen a short-scale string for it to fit a long-scale bass...) will not result in bad tone due to the string being intended for a different scale, but simply a different tone. Perhaps very slightly so.

Finally, I still believe that the majority of manufacturers do in fact not make, say, a short-scale .105 nickel-plated roundwound and a long-scale .105 one that are any different in construction other than in length.
